Attached the file?!!
I've recieved emails in which the sender writes,"Please find attached the file"!! Is that English? I mean is it correct English? I argued with some coleagues who told me it's commonly used. I've learned to write,"Please find the attached file"

You are right that 'Please find the attached file' seems more logical grammatically.
However, the other construction is an established formula that goes back a long time. Before the days of email attachments, we wrote letters saying 'Please find enclosed:...' , followed by what you were enclosing in the envelope. This formula works better if you have a number of items. 'Please find attached' is a kind of heading, followed by a list of attachments.
